Established in 1997, the Netaji Subhas Open University is a UGC-approved University. The university offers courses in distance mode. It has been accredited by NAAC with an A grade and has also been recognised by DEC and the Gov. of West Bengal. It is also an active member of the Association of Indian Universities (AIU), the Association of Asian Open University (AAOU), and the Association of Commonwealth Universities (ACU).

Food and Beverage Director and General Manager of a premier international hotel chain hold highest earning position in Tourism industry.
Food & Beverage Director is responsible for managing all parts of organization's food and beverage planning and service like -
- menu planning
- costing
- preparing and presenting food and beverages
- adhering to quality and safety requirements
